Step 1: Initial Assessment

Within 60 minutes of your call, our team arrives to assess the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and develop a plan to extract the water and dry out your home.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ful water extraction equ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ors and submersible pumps to remove as much water as possible from your home.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and ventilation equipment to dry out your home completely. This process can take 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of your home.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once your home is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ize all affected areas, including carpets, upholstery, and other belongings. This ensures your home is not only safe but also free from any lingering moisture or contaminants.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is completely dry and safe. We’ll provide you with a detailed report and any necessary recommendations for future maintenance and prevention.

Warning Signs You Need Water Extraction Help

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s, safety hazards, and even health issues. Catch them early and save yourself a lot of stress and money.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

You’ll know it’s time to call us when you notice persistent musty smells in your home. This could be a sign of moisture or mold growth in your walls, ceilings, or floors.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Don’t ignore these stains as they can show water damage or leaks somewhere in your home. We’ll help you find and fix the source of the problem before it causes more damage.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Water damage can warp or buckle your floors making them unsafe to walk on. Our team will assess the damage and provide the necessary repairs to get your floors back to normal.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ture or water damage in your walls. We’ll help you address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Visible Water Damage on Countertops or Sinks

Don’t dismiss visible water damage on your countertops or sinks. We’ll help you fix the issue and prevent further damage to your home’s surfaces.

High Humidity Levels in Your Home

High humidity can lead to condensation and moisture buildup in your home. Our team will help you assess and address the issue to prevent mold growth and other problems.

Residential Water Extraction Cost in Lake Morton, WA

The cost of water extraction services in Lake Morton,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the amount of water, and the equipment needed.
Dehumidification and ventilation $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ment needed.
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 The extent of the damage and the type of surfaces affected.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a detailed estimate provided by our team. We offer free estimates and are happy to answer any questions you may have about the process and costs involved.

Common Questions About Residential Water Extraction

Is water extraction covered by my insurance?

Your insurance policy may cover some or all of the costs associated with water extraction and repairs. But, the specifics of your coverage will dep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. We recommend checking with your insurance provider to understand what’s covered and what’s not.

How long does the water extraction process take?

The length of the process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ete. Our team will provide you with a detailed timeline and regular updates throughout the process.

Can I stay in my home during the water extraction process?

It’s generally not recommended to stay in your home while water extraction is taking place. The process can be messy and may involve strong odors, humidity, and noise. We recommend arranging for temporary accommodations during the process for the health and safety of you and your family.
